The analyst price target for Zenith Bank has been raised from ₦69.28 to ₦73.30 as analysts factor in enhanced revenue growth expectations, even though there is a slight moderation in profit margin forecasts.

Valuation Changes
- Consensus Analyst Price Target has increased from NGN 69.28 to NGN 73.30, reflecting an improved valuation outlook.
- Discount Rate rose marginally from 29.51% to 29.70%.
- Revenue Growth Forecast was revised upward from 14.28% to 19.79%.
- Net Profit Margin expectation decreased from 43.95% to 41.58%.
- Future P/E ratio moved up modestly from 4.99x to 5.10x.
